The lipid bilayer is made of phospholipids. They are arranged in a double layer because one of their ends is attracted to water while the other is repelled by water.

For about 100 years, scientists thought that peptic ulcers were caused by stress, spicy food, and alcohol. Later, researchers added stomach acid to the list of causes and began treating ulcers with antacids. Now it is known that peptic ulcers are predominantly caused by Helicobacter pylori, a spiral-shaped bacterium that normally exist in the stomach.
